Two bearings are typically pressed into the rocker from either side, with the radial bearings facing outwards. Inboard suspension systems are often featured on high downforce cars such as this Oreca LMP1 chassis. A common use for this style is in rocker pivots on cars with inboard suspension.

The "combination" design features needle rollers arranged axially around the bore for rotation, plus another set of needle rollers arranged radially at one end for thrust. Nadella bearings are used in many racecar applications because of their small size, low weight, and high load capacity.
